- Bell Tower with a front gate to the St Michael Golden Dome Cathedral/Дзвіниця Михайлівського Золотоверхого Собору, Kyiv, Ukraine by Leonid Firsov
-
The stone temple of the Holy Archistratigus Michael founded on June 11th 1108 by the Prince Svyatopolk (Christened as Mykhaylo).
